Evaluation of Peak Overpressure and Impulse Induced by Explosion (폭발에 따른 최대과압 및 충격량 평가)

  • Yoon, Yong-Kyun
    • Explosives and Blasting
    • /
    • v.34 no.4
    • /
    • pp.28-34
    • /
    • 2016
  • Empirical model, phenomenological model, and CFD model have been used to evaluate the blast effects produced by explosion of explosives, flammable gas and liquid or dust. TNT equivalence method which is one of empirical models has been widely used as it is simple. In this study, new peak overpressure-scaled distance and scaled impulse-scaled distance equations are induced through fitting data from the curves given by TNT equivalence method. If the TNT equivalent mass is calculated, it is possible to estimate the peak overpressure and impulse using the regression equations. Differences of peak overpressure with yield factor which is a component of TNT equivalence method are found to be great in near-by distances from explosion source where the increase in overpressure is very steep, but the differences are getting smaller as the distances increase.

Development and Application of an Explosion Modeling Technique Using PFC (PFC3D에서의 폭원모델링 기법의 개발 및 적용)

  • Choi Byung-Hee;Yang Hyung-Sik;Ryu Chang-Ha
    • Explosives and Blasting
    • /
    • v.22 no.4
    • /
    • pp.7-15
    • /
    • 2004
  • An explosion modeling technique was developed by using the spherical discrete element code, PFC3D, which can be used to model the dynamic stress wave propagation phenomenon. The modeling technique is simply based on an idea that the explosion pressure should be applied to a PFC3D particle assembly not in the form of an external force (body force), but in the form of a contact force (surface force). According to this concept, the explosion pressure is applied to the wall particles by the scheme of radius expansion/contraction of inner-hole particles. The output wall force is compared to the input hole pressure in every time step, and a correction routine is activated to control the radius multiplier of the inner-hole particles. A comparative blast simulation far a cement mortar block of $80\times90\times80mm$ was conducted by using the conventional explosion modeling method and the new one. The results of the simulation are presented in a qualitative fashion.

Effect of Mean Diameter on the Explosion Characteristic of Magnesium Dusts (마그네슘의 폭발특성에 미치는 평균입경의 영향)

  • Han, Ou-Sup;Lee, Su-Hee
    • Journal of the Korean Institute of Gas
    • /
    • v.17 no.4
    • /
    • pp.33-38
    • /
    • 2013
  • A study was carried out on the effect of particle size (mean diameter) on magnesium dust explosion. Experimental investigations were conducted in a 20-L explosion sphere, using 10 kJ chemical ignitors. Explosion tests were performed with three different dusts having mean diameter (38, 142, $567{\mu}m$) and the dust concentrations were up to $2250g/m^3$. The lower explosion limits(LEL) of magnesium dusts were about $30g/m^3$ at $38{\mu}m$ and $40g/m^3$ at $142{\mu}m$. LEL tended to increase with particle size and this means that the explosion probability of magnesium dust decreased with increase of particle size. The maximum explosion presssure ($P_m$) and $K_{st}$ (Explosion index) decreased with the increase of particle size. For magnesium powder of $567{\mu}m$, however, the explosive properties were not observed in the 5 kJ ignition energy.
